We are seeking an experienced and highly skilled System Engineer (Network)

Responsibilities


1. Network Design and Implementation:
o Evaluate organizational requirements and design efficient computer networks.
o Install and configure network hardware, including routers, switches, firewalls, load balancers, VPNs, and quality of service (QoS) devices.
o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ure network scalability and future growth.

 

2. Network Maintenance and Upgrades:
o Perform routine network maintenance tasks, such as applying service packs, patches, hot fixes, and security configurations.
o Monitor system resource utilization, trends, and capacity planning.
o Troubleshoot and resolve network issues promptly.

 

3. Security and Risk Mitigation:
o Implement security tools, policies, and procedures in coordination with the company’s security team.
o Architect and engineer secure network solutions to protect against cyberattacks and hacking threats.
o Conduct assessments, penetration testing, and vulnerability management.

 

4. Collaboration and Communication:
o Work within established configuration and change management policies.
o Liaise with vendors and other IT personnel to resolve technical challenges.
o Provide Level-2/3 support for network-related incidents.
